Times Aerospace F1 Coating Thickness Gauge Probe is an optional probe for TT260 Coating Thickness Gauge, with a thickness measurement range of 0-1250 microns, a resolution of 0.1 microns, and a minimum critical thickness of 0.5mm, which is a magnetic probe.

TIMES F1 probeSpecifications
| LIST | VALUE |
|---|---|
| Measurement principle | magnetic Induction |
| Measurement range | 0~1250μm |
| margin of error | One point calibrate (μm ) : +/- [ 3% H + 1], two point calibrate (μm ): +/- [( 1~ 3) % H + 1] |
| resolution | 0.1μm |
| Minimum measurement surface | Φ7mm |
| Minimum radius of curvature | Convex 1.5mm |
| thinnest substrate | 0.5mm |
| probe | F1 |
